Commercial Slab Construction in Gig Harbor, WA
Commercial slab construction services involve the preparation and pouring of concrete slabs that serve as the foundation for various types of commercial buildings, such as warehouses, retail stores, office spaces, and industrial facilities. These projects typically require a durable, level base that can support heavy loads and withstand ongoing use. Property owners often seek information about the scope of the work, including site preparation, reinforcement, and finishing details, to ensure the project meets structural and safety standards. Understanding the specific requirements of the intended building and the conditions of the construction site is essential before requesting these services.
Before requesting commercial slab construction, property owners should consider factors such as the size and design of the slab, load-bearing needs, and any site-specific challenges like soil stability or drainage. Clarifying these details helps ensure the project aligns with the building’s purpose and longevity. It’s also important to discuss any permits or regulations that may apply locally. Having a clear understanding of the project scope and requirements can facilitate a smooth construction process and help achieve a solid, long-lasting foundation for commercial development.

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or work areas on property sites.
What materials are commonly used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the primary material, often reinforced with steel to enhance strength and durability.
How thick should a commercial slab be? Thickness varies based on the load requirements, typically ranging from 4 to 12 inches for different applications.
What should property owners consider before starting a slab project? Proper site preparation, drainage planning, and understanding load needs are essential for a successful installation.
